On Sunday, Mohun Bagan Super Giant hosts the Odisha FC match in an Indian Super League (ISL) 2024-25 match at the Salt Lake Stadium stadium, seeking to achieve the victory that would bring the title of Shield League for the second time.
The navies have already completed certain records on 49 points from 21 outings – which is the highest accumulation of any team in the history of the ISL – and are now ready to create history by becoming The first club of the tournament to secure successive league titles.
Mohun Bagan currently has a seven points advance on the second FC Goa (42 points in 21 games) and needs 52 points to win the title.

Despite three additional games to play, Mohun Bagan will try to secure the crown by beating Odisha FC, in front of a crowd of capacity.

The confidence of the navy is based on the series of success that the team has succeeded by remaining undefeated in its last 10 houses.
He also managed clean leaves in the last five games (between 13 clean leaves in the tournament), making it one of the most resolved teams on the tournament.
Mohun Bagan is the only side that has maintained the appropriate balance in its performance setting up a resolved defense, which has only conceded 14 goals so far, and an effective attack producing the 42 highest goals.

“The most important thing is a difficult work through which you get the necessary balance. At the beginning (of the tournament), we did not have this balance but we found it later. And this balance and hard work have helped us to be where we are right now, “said Mohun Bagan’s head coach Jose Molina.
“In football, you cannot separate defense and attacks. You must have everything good to be a good team. And that’s what we’re trying to do from the start. »»

For Odisha FC, which is currently placed seventh in the league painting with 29 points of 21 matches, this is a matter of survival.
With only three remaining games, the task has become difficult for the behemoths, who need points in all their outings to eliminate a place in the upper half of the league table and stay in the running for the ISL Cup, which is the Next stage of the tournament.

Odisha has achieved an excellent 41 goals’ attack record so far, which is the best in Mohun Bagan. But his attacker force was largely offset by an unstable defense which left 34 goals to spoil the situation.

“We play practically three finals and in doing so, we need to get the opportunity to finish in the top six. We are going to go to try to win, because it is very important for us to get a positive result, “said the head coach of the Odisha FC, Sergio Lobera.
“We will play for us. And if that means that the opposing team cannot celebrate something, we have to focus on our target, “the visit coach took up the challenge to the local team.
The two teams clashed 12 times in the competition, Mohun Bagan winning five times and FC Odisha emerging victorious once. Six games produced prints, including the reverse light on November 10, 2024, which ended 1-1.
